看板 Math 關於我們 聯絡資訊
昨天看到一個新聞 http://www.setn.com/News.aspx?NewsID=215104 以下是他求解的方式: 李哲愷是怎麼算出來的,一一解析他的步驟。他先利用軟體畫出台灣島內最大的圓,然後 再以東西岸的海岸線找出5個以上的地點當圓心,以最大的圓畫出無法交界的區域,之後 再不斷放大半徑,縮小區域範圍,最後把面積縮小到一個點,找出座標,就是阿里山。 我有幾個問題: 1、如何找出台灣島內最大的圓?並證明這個圓是最大的 2、找出5個以上的地點當圓心,如果是隨便找的,那不同次的結果也會一樣嗎? 最後一個問題就是標題問的 如果給一個不規則封閉線段 如何找出內包的最大圓 我個人的想法是 在數學上應該很難做出一個通用的演算法 因為線段的點有無限多個 如果說允許誤差 比方說0.1個單位 然後將區線用0.1個單位分割成有限點 再設計演算法用電腦跑應該比較有機會 不知道大家有沒有什麼不錯的想法 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 1.175.133.130 ※ 文章網址: https://www.ptt.cc/bbs/Math/M.1484108633.A.433.html
BVB : 不太懂五的點的意義,最大圓的圓心不就是他想要的嗎 01/11 16:45
BVB :     個 01/11 16:45
LiamIssac : 似乎是個經典的optimization問題 01/11 16:59
LiamIssac : google "how to find the biggest circle" 01/11 17:02
ddxu2 : 任取三個邊(跑遍所有組合),找出其構成三角形的內 01/12 22:06
ddxu2 : 切圓,檢查圓心是否落在多邊形裡,如果落在裡面,以 01/12 22:06
ddxu2 : 圓心對所有邊作垂線段至圓周,檢查該垂線段是否與多 01/12 22:06
ddxu2 : 邊形相交,若皆否,記下該圓心與其半徑。 01/12 22:06
ddxu2 : 跑遍所有組合後,半徑最大的那組應該就是了? 01/12 22:06
recorriendo : Chebyshev center 多邊形的話用線性規劃就可以解了 01/14 09:47